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further water from spreading.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and prevent it from seeping into other areas of your home.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your basement, reducing the risk of further damage and ensuring that your home is safe and secure.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your basement, ensuring that it’s safe and secure for you and your family to use.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your basement, removing any dirt, debris, or bacteria that may have been left behind.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Our team will work with you to restore your basement to its original condition, repairing any damage and ensuring that it’s safe and secure for you and your family to use.

Basement Water Extraction Cost in New River, AZ
The cost of Basement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in New River, AZ.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your unique needs and bud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Moisture Detection and Testing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Containment and Sealing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
